The document describes several musical instruments used in Colonial America, including the fife, cittern, baroque guitar, and harpsichord. The fife was a small flute played by males in the military. The cittern was a 10-string instrument tuned to an open C chord and played by women. The baroque guitar was similar to modern guitars but without a low E string and mostly played by women. The harpsichord was a keyboard instrument that used a mechanism to pluck its strings instead of hammers like a piano.
